Management Commentary
During the accompanying earnings call, Rexford leadership highlighted key operational trends that shaped Q1 2026 performance, without disclosing proprietary or unfinalized financial details. Management noted that the company’s core portfolio of infill industrial properties continued to see strong demand from tenants across logistics, e-commerce, and advanced manufacturing segments, which has supported healthy rental rate resets for expiring leases. They also addressed the absence of full revenue data in the initial release, noting that finalized top-line figures, alongside full portfolio occupancy and rental growth metrics, will be included in the company’s upcoming 10-Q filing with the SEC, expected to be submitted in the next few weeks. Management also touched on the company’s capital allocation strategy for the quarter, noting that they pursued selective acquisitions of high-quality infill assets in markets with limited new supply, while prioritizing balance sheet strength amid elevated interest rate volatility. No specific deal volumes or acquisition costs were disclosed during the call, in line with the partial initial disclosure approach.

Forward Guidance
Rexford (REXR) shared preliminary, qualitative forward guidance alongside its Q1 2026 earnings release, avoiding specific quantitative projections pending finalization of full quarterly financials. Management noted that they expect structural demand for infill industrial space to remain solid in their core operating markets, where new supply growth remains constrained by high land costs and zoning restrictions. This dynamic could potentially support further rental rate growth across the portfolio in upcoming periods, though management cautioned that this trend is not guaranteed. They also outlined potential headwinds that may impact performance moving forward, including higher financing costs for new acquisitions, possible softening in tenant demand if macroeconomic growth slows, and regulatory changes that could impact development activity in some of their core markets. Management stated that they will provide full quantitative guidance for the rest of the year when they release their full 10-Q filing for Q1 2026.

Market Reaction
Following the release of Q1 2026 earnings, REXR saw moderate trading volume in recent sessions, as investors digested the partial financial results and operational updates. Analysts covering the industrial REIT sector have noted that the reported adjusted EPS figure aligns with broad consensus market expectations, though most firms are holding formal updates to their outlook on Rexford until the full 10-Q with revenue and portfolio performance data is released. Some analyst notes published in the days following the earnings call have highlighted that management’s commentary on rental demand and supply constraints signals potential resilience in REXR’s core portfolio, relative to peers with more exposure to markets with elevated new industrial supply. The stock’s price action following the release was in line with broader sector trends for industrial REITs, with no outsized moves observed in either direction in the immediate aftermath of the announcement.
